Egypt property The property market in Egypt is primarily focused around the Red sea and Mediterranean coastline. Property investors are also buying in and around the main urban hubs of Cairo, Alexandria and Luxor, The Egyptian governments pro-active policies for attracting overseas investment has created an economic climate geared for growth in the Egyptian property market. Smile Hania Beach, Central Hurghada, Egypt - Due for completion Summer '09.

Just put down a £2,000 reservation on this pre-release. Priced at £700 per Sqm. Will go up to £800 on the 01.03.08. Developer will have a presenation on the 29.02.08, where if interested I can choose my apartment (2 bed 71 sqm at £50,000). 40% payable upfont and remainder 60% payable on completion.

Mortgage with large international bank written into contract for 60%. I have been told that this will involve a UK developer, 40% will be kept in Escrow account until completion and the apartments will overlook the beach and sea.

I have also been told that the finishing will be "incomparable" when compared against other developments in the area.

Its beach-front in Al Ahyaa (on the road between Hurghada and El Gouna).

This is where most new developements beach-front will be released this year as its the only stretch you can find decent beach-front plots. The government also has plans to promenade the main road along this stretch leaving cars to use the other outside high-road towards El Gouna and Cairo. Should be a great place to invest and get in early.
